Home Styles & Community Feel

Homes here are primarily single-family residences, with a mix of established properties from the late 1970s and 1980s alongside newer construction and custom rebuilds. Many homes feature open living areas, chef’s kitchens, and outdoor rooms that make the most of the island setting. You’ll also see details that suit life near the coast: elevators, large porches, pool areas, and durable finishes such as quartzite counters, wood cabinetry, and modern mechanical systems. Garage space is common, and several homes are designed with deeper storage or multi-bay parking, which adds a useful layer of convenience.

The overall feel is refined but not overly formal. Some homes lean toward classic island character, while others bring a more contemporary resort-style presentation. Golf course frontage, lagoon views, and occasional waterfront positioning give the neighborhood a scenic rhythm that changes from street to street.

Location & Schools

Middlewoods East is set on Kiawah Island, with the community’s center around the island’s golf-and-beach corridor near Green Winged Teal Road, Sea Marsh Drive, Saltmeadow Cove, Sparrow Hawk Road, and Palm Warbler Road. Freshfields Village is about 5 minutes away from one listing and described as minutes away from another, while historic Charleston is approximately 45 minutes away. Nearby destinations named in the remarks include Kiawah’s beaches, Night Heron Park Nature Center, Marsh View Tower, The Sandcastle, and the Kiawah River.

School assignments are listed as Angel Oak ES 4K-1 / Johns Island ES 2-5, Haut Gap Middle, and St. Johns High. That combination places the community within the broader Johns Island/Kiawah education corridor while keeping the island setting front and center.
